I have a Toshiba Satellite P875-S7102. I swapped out the HDD with a new one and installed Win7 Home Premium 64-bit, added 8 GBs of RAM (16 total), updated all necessary drivers and installed Serato DJ Intro. I only use this for my DJ music, connecting to intenret every so often for updates. Everything's been fine until tonight when I tried to rename a music file. When I clicked to put the cursor where I wanted, it acted like I was holding the space bar and would not stop until I hit the space bar. After typing a few letters, it would start moving the cursor again by itself. I tried it in notebok and same problem.
Tonight was the first time in about two weeks that I've used this particular laptop. It's been sitting unplugged for that period of time. Has anybody heard of this problem on any laptop? I've had this laptop since August 2013.

I found a forum which says to "switch user", which I thought would not work since I am the only user. But, it worked, and I am able to continue my never ending quest to type in song titles and artists. Consider this thread SOLVED! Thanks.
